PHP常用的關(guān)鍵字

    時間:2024-08-18 02:25:06 PHP 我要投稿
    • 相關(guān)推薦

    PHP常用的關(guān)鍵字

      PHP可編譯成具有與許多數(shù)據(jù)庫相連接的函數(shù)。將自己編寫外圍的函數(shù)去間接存取數(shù)據(jù)庫。通過這樣的途徑當更換使用的數(shù)據(jù)庫時,可以輕松地修改編碼以適應這樣的變化。下文yjbys小編為大家分享的是PHP常用關(guān)鍵字,一起來看看吧!

      final:在PHP中final關(guān)鍵字充當鎖的作用,當定義類的時候該類不能被繼承,當用來定義方法的時候該方法不能被重載

      self:用來訪問當前類中內(nèi)容的關(guān)鍵字,類似于$this關(guān)鍵字,但$this需要類實例化后才能使用,$this不能夠訪問類中的靜態(tài)成員,self可以直接訪問當前類中的內(nèi)部成員,包括靜態(tài)成員。$this關(guān)鍵字類實例化后可以使用,也可以在類的內(nèi)容訪問非靜態(tài)化成員

      static:單獨占據(jù)內(nèi)存,只初始化一次,訪問靜態(tài)成員要用::,類中的靜態(tài)成員和方法可以直接訪問,不需要實例化

      const:用來定義類中的常量,類似PHP外部定義的常量的關(guān)鍵字define();CONSET只能修飾類當中的成員屬性!常量建議都大寫,不使用$

      關(guān)鍵字是不需要加$的。在類中訪問常量也是用self關(guān)鍵字

      舉例:

      /*

      * Created on 2012-2-12

      *

      * To change the template for this generated file go to

      * Window - Preferences - PHPeclipse - PHP - Code Templates

      */

      abstract class cl1

      {

      static $ss='我的電腦';//靜態(tài)成員變量

      public $aa='你的電腦';

      abstract function fun1();

      abstract function fun2();

      abstract function fun3();

      function ok()

      {

      echo self::$ss;//在類的內(nèi)部訪問static成員也要用的self關(guān)鍵字

      echo $this->aa;

      }

      }

      class cl2 extends cl1

      {

      function fun1()

      {

      }

      function fun2()

      {

      }

      function fun3()

      {

      return 1;

      }

      }

      $instance=new cl2();

      echo $instance->fun3().$instance->ok();

      echo cl1::$ss;//無需實例化也可以訪問到變量ss?>

    【PHP常用的關(guān)鍵字】相關(guān)文章:

    關(guān)于php的常用運行方式04-02

    JavaScript中的with關(guān)鍵字03-25

    關(guān)于php面試寶典及PHP面試技巧04-02

    關(guān)于編程之PHP常用MySql操作的方法04-02

    PHP中date函數(shù)常用時間處理方法03-31

    BEC閱讀需要掌握的關(guān)鍵字03-03

    PHP的壓縮函數(shù)03-31

    php高級教程01-23

    淺析php函數(shù)的實例04-01

    91久久大香伊蕉在人线_国产综合色产在线观看_欧美亚洲人成网站在线观看_亚洲第一无码精品立川理惠

      在线视频国产一区不卡 | 日本精品中文字幕 | 天天看片国产区 | 一区二区三区四区在线视频 | 偷自拍亚洲综合在线不卡 | 一本大道香蕉青青久久 |